📖 Definitions of "Longlegged"

adjective
  1. 1

    Having long legs.

  2. 2

    Of an aircraft or ship: having large operational range.

    "The pilots were flying planes that were not only light and highly maneuverable; they were extremely long-legged, able to cover a greater distance than their American counterparts."
